[leafnode-list] ln2: PCRE filtering body?



I have code in "store.c" that could be activated: it calls
"killfilter(f, mastr_str(body))" depending on the compile time option
"FILTER_BODY_PCRE".  The reason this is not on by default is missing
syntax for body filtering in the stock killfile "etc/leafnode/filters".

We have "newsgroups" to select newsgroups, "pattern" to match headers
on and "action" to specify some score.  If we don't provide something
special for body patterns, people could drop good articles when they
cite bad articles just because part of the body matches an unwanted
header pattern.

What should we do about this?
